aboutsummaryrefslogtreecommitdiff
path: root/tcg/tci.c
AgeCommit message (Expand)Author
2022-02-09tcg/tci: Support raising sigbus for user-onlyRichard Henderson
2022-01-08exec/memop: Adding signedness to quad definitionsFrédéric Pétrot
2021-10-13tcg: Move helper_*_mmu decls to tcg/tcg-ldst.hRichard Henderson
2021-10-05tcg: Rename TCGMemOpIdx to MemOpIdxRichard Henderson
2021-06-29tcg/tci: Support bswap flagsRichard Henderson
2021-06-19tcg/tci: Use {set,clear}_helper_retaddrRichard Henderson
2021-06-19tcg/tci: Remove the qemu_ld/st_type macrosRichard Henderson
2021-06-19Revert "tcg/tci: Use exec/cpu_ldst.h interfaces"Richard Henderson
2021-06-19tcg/tci: Split out tci_qemu_ld, tci_qemu_stRichard Henderson
2021-06-19tcg/tci: Implement add2, sub2Richard Henderson
2021-06-19tcg/tci: Implement mulu2, muls2Richard Henderson
2021-06-19tcg/tci: Implement clz, ctz, ctpopRichard Henderson
2021-06-19tcg/tci: Implement extract, sextractRichard Henderson
2021-06-19tcg/tci: Implement andc, orc, eqv, nand, norRichard Henderson
2021-06-19tcg/tci: Implement movcondRichard Henderson
2021-06-19tcg/tci: Implement goto_ptrRichard Henderson
2021-06-19tcg/tci: Change encoding to uint32_t unitsRichard Henderson
2021-06-19tcg/tci: Remove tci_write_regRichard Henderson
2021-06-19tcg/tci: Emit setcond before brcondRichard Henderson
2021-06-19tcg/tci: Use ffi for callsRichard Henderson
2021-03-17tcg/tci: Implement the disassembler properlyRichard Henderson
2021-03-17tcg/tci: Hoist op_size checking into tci_args_*Richard Henderson
2021-03-17tcg/tci: Split out tci_args_{rrm,rrrm,rrrrm}Richard Henderson
2021-03-17tcg/tci: Reduce qemu_ld/st TCGMemOpIdx operand to 32-bitsRichard Henderson
2021-03-17tcg/tci: Clean up deposit operationsR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rrrR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rrrrrRichard Henderson
2021-03-17tcg/tci: Reuse tci_args_l for goto_tbRichard Henderson
2021-03-17tcg/tci: Reuse tci_args_l for exit_tbRichard Henderson
2021-03-17tcg/tci: Reuse tci_args_l for calls.Richard Henderson
2021-03-17tcg/tci: Split out tci_args_ri and tci_args_rIR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rcl and tci_args_rrrrclR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rrrrcRichard Henderson
2021-03-17tcg/tci: Split out tci_args_lR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rrcR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rrR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rRichard Henderson
2021-03-17tcg/tci: Split out tci_args_rrsRichard Henderson
2021-03-17tcg/tci: Rename tci_read_r to tci_read_rvalRichard Henderson
2021-03-17tcg/tci: Remove ifdefs for TCG_TARGET_HAS_ext32[us]_i64Richard Henderson
2021-03-06tcg/tci: Merge mov, not and neg operationsRichard Henderson
2021-03-06tcg/tci: Merge bswap operationsRichard Henderson
2021-03-06tcg/tci: Merge extension operationsRichard Henderson
2021-03-06tcg/tci: Merge basic arithmetic operationsRichard Henderson
2021-03-06tcg/tci: Reduce use of tci_read_r64Richard Henderson
2021-03-06tcg/tci: Remove tci_read_r32sRichard Henderson
2021-03-06tcg/tci: Remove tci_read_r32Richard Henderson
2021-03-06tcg/tci: Remove tci_read_r16sRichard Henderson
2021-03-06tcg/tci: Remove tci_read_r16Richard Henderson
2021-03-06tcg/tci: Remove tci_read_r8sRichard Henderson